My guess would be the attatchment or dangle to an Imperial veterans shield. The shield is usually a white metal crown, crossed swords and bandau with Deutscher Krieger bund on it with crossed red, white & black ribbons behind. The dangle usually has the name of a town or unit. Yours appears to be a unit. These usually measure 1-11/4". The shields can frequently be found on ebay minus the dangle cheap.
